Understanding Essential Oils: What are They and How Do They Work?
Essential oils are highly concentrated plant extracts that capture the natural fragrance and beneficial properties of plants. They are typically extracted through methods such as steam distillation or cold pressing. These oils contain the essence of the plant, including its aroma and therapeutic properties.
When it comes to hair care, essential oils work by penetrating the scalp and hair follicles, nourishing them with their potent compounds. They can stimulate blood circulation in the scalp, promote cell regeneration, and provide essential nutrients to the hair follicles. This helps to strengthen the hair strands, promote healthy hair growth, and increase hair density.

Essential Oil Safety: How to Use Them Safely and Effectively
While essential oils can be highly beneficial for hair care, it’s important to use them safely and effectively to avoid any adverse reactions or skin sensitivities.
1. Dilution Guidelines: Essential oils are highly concentrated and should always be diluted before use. The general rule of thumb is to use a 2-3% dilution rate, which means adding 12-15 drops of essential oil per ounce of carrier oil or other base ingredient.
2. Patch Testing: Before using any new essential oil on your scalp or hair, it’s important to perform a patch test to check for any allergic reactions or sensitivities. Apply a small amount of diluted essential oil to a small area of skin and wait 24 hours to see if any adverse reactions occur.
3. Safe Usage Tips: Avoid applying undiluted essential oils directly to the scalp or hair, as this can cause irritation. Always mix them with a carrier oil or other base ingredient before use. It’s also important to avoid getting essential oils in your eyes or mucous membranes, as they can cause irritation.
The Best Carrier Oils to Use with Essential Oils for Hair Growth
Carrier oils are used to dilute essential oils and help carry them onto the scalp and hair strands. They also provide additional nourishment and moisture to the hair.
Some of the best carrier oils for hair growth include:
1. Jojoba Oil: Jojoba oil is similar in composition to the natural oils produced by the scalp, making it an excellent choice for all hair types. It moisturizes the hair without leaving a greasy residue and helps balance the scalp’s oil production.
2. Coconut Oil: Coconut oil is rich in fatty acids that penetrate the hair shaft, nourishing and strengthening the hair from within. It also has antimicrobial properties that can help prevent scalp infections and promote a healthy scalp.
3. Argan Oil: Argan oil is packed with antioxidants, vitamins, and fatty acids that nourish and moisturize the hair. It can help repair damaged hair, reduce frizz, and add shine and softness.
4. Castor Oil: Castor oil is known for its ability to promote hair growth and increase hair density. It contains ricinoleic acid, which has anti-inflammatory properties that can soothe the scalp and promote healthy hair growth.
DIY Essential Oil Hair Treatments: Recipes and How-Tos
There are many DIY hair treatments that you can make at home using essential oils to promote hair growth and increase hair density.
1. DIY Hair Mask Recipes:
– Mix 2 tablespoons of coconut oil, 1 tablespoon of honey, and 5 drops of rosemary essential oil. Apply to damp hair, leave on for 30 minutes, and then rinse thoroughly.
– Combine 2 tablespoons of argan oil, 1 tablespoon of castor oil, and 5 drops of lavender essential oil. Massage into the scalp and hair, leave on for 1 hour, and then shampoo as usual.
2. DIY Hair Oil Recipes:
– Mix 2 tablespoons of jojoba oil, 1 tablespoon of almond oil, and 5 drops of peppermint essential oil. Massage into the scalp and hair, leave on overnight, and then shampoo in the morning.
– Combine 2 tablespoons of coconut oil, 1 tablespoon of avocado oil, and 5 drops of cedarwood essential oil. Apply to damp hair, leave on for 1 hour, and then rinse thoroughly.
3. How to Use Essential Oils in Your Hair Care Routine:
– Add a few drops of your chosen essential oil to your shampoo or conditioner before each use.
– Create a DIY hair spray by mixing water with a few drops of essential oil in a spray bottle. Use it as a leave-in conditioner or to refresh your hair throughout the day.
Essential Oils for Scalp Health: Addressing Common Scalp Issues
A healthy scalp is essential for promoting hair growth and maintaining overall hair health. Essential oils can help address common scalp issues such as dandruff, itchiness, oily scalp, and dry scalp.
1. Dandruff: Essential oils like tea tree, lavender, and eucalyptus have antimicrobial properties that can help combat the fungus responsible for dandruff. They can also soothe the scalp and reduce inflammation.
2. Itchy Scalp: Peppermint, chamomile, and lavender essential oils have soothing properties that can help relieve itchiness and irritation on the scalp. They can also promote a healthy scalp environment.
3. Oily Scalp: Lemon, rosemary, and tea tree essential oils have astringent properties that can help regulate sebum production and reduce oiliness on the scalp. They can also help unclog hair follicles and promote a healthy scalp.
4. Dry Scalp: Essential oils like geranium, ylang-ylang, and sandalwood have moisturizing properties that can help hydrate and nourish a dry scalp. They can also soothe inflammation and promote a healthy scalp environment.
Essential Oils for Hair Loss: Can They Really Help?
Hair loss can be a frustrating and distressing issue for many people. While essential oils cannot magically regrow hair, they can help support a healthy scalp environment and promote hair growth.
Some essential oils that may help with hair loss include:
1. Rosemary Oil: Rosemary oil has been shown to increase hair count and thickness in people with androgenetic alopecia, a common form of hair loss. It stimulates blood circulation in the scalp and promotes hair growth.
2. Cedarwood Oil: Cedarwood oil has been found to improve hair growth in people with alopecia areata, an autoimmune condition that causes hair loss. It stimulates the hair follicles and promotes healthy hair growth.
3. Lavender Oil: Lavender oil has been shown to promote hair growth by increasing the number of hair follicles in mice studies. It also has calming properties that can help reduce stress, which is often associated with hair loss.
While more research is needed to fully understand the effects of essential oils on hair loss, these oils have shown promising results in preliminary studies.

Essential Oil Blends for Maximum Hair Growth and Density
Creating essential oil blends can help target specific hair concerns and maximize the benefits of different oils.
Some essential oil blends for different hair types and concerns include:
1. Dry Hair Blend: Mix 3 drops of lavender oil, 3 drops of rosemary oil, and 2 drops of sandalwood oil. Dilute in a carrier oil and apply to damp hair.
2. Oily Hair Blend: Combine 3 drops of lemon oil, 3 drops of tea tree oil, and 2 drops of peppermint oil. Dilute in a carrier oil and massage into the scalp.
3. Damaged Hair Blend: Mix 3 drops of ylang-ylang oil, 3 drops of clary sage oil, and 2 drops of cedarwood oil. Dilute in a carrier oil and apply to damp hair.
4. Thinning Hair Blend: Combine 3 drops of rosemary oil, 3 drops of cedarwood oil, and 2 drops of lavender oil. Dilute in a carrier oil and massage into the scalp.
